Product Description:
The CSB02.1B-ET-EC-EC-NN-DA-NN-AW drive controller is produced by Bosch Rexroth Indramat for the CSB Drive Controllers series. Designed for servo and spindle duties, the unit integrates motion logic, feedback processing, and network interfaces so a single cabinet module can command automation axes in packaging lines, handling gantries, or machine tools. It accepts encoder signals, manages power to the connected inverter stage, and forwards status data over industrial Ethernet, providing deterministic control of motor position and torque.
This controller operates from a 24 VDC control supply and draws a base load of 17 W, keeping standby heat low inside the panel. Command data and diagnostics travel through the integrated 100Base-TX port, and the backplane also supports Multi-Ethernet protocols for mixed real-time networks. The voltage input channel offers a bandwidth of 1.3 kHz, an input resistance of 300 kΩ, and a resolution of 14 bit, so finely scaled reference signals can be interpreted without external conditioning. Digital or analog I/O extension modules can be added, and encoder feedback is accepted on two independent multi-encoder ports. The controller does not include integrated safety technology, so external relays must interrupt the drive enable circuit when risk conditions are detected.
The single-axis capacity is rated at 1, matching machines that dedicate one controller per mechanical axis. Position feedback can be sourced from 12 V or 5 V encoders; each supply rail can deliver 500 mA, and the same current is available on the programmable digital outputs for solenoid or relay actuation. When analog process data must be retransmitted to higher-level PLCs, the output settles within 250 µs, supporting tight closed-loop cycles. Network interchange supports Multi-Ethernet, allowing selection between EtherNet/IP, PROFINET, or EtherCAT without hardware changes. Encoder current monitoring, voltage-input resolution, and a base power meter support diagnostic visibility during operation.
